คุณสมบัติ screenX ของ MouseEvent

คำอธิบายและวิธีใช้

คุณสมบัติ screenX กลับค่าตำแหน่งตัวชิ้นส่วนของตัวชิ้นส่วนนี้เมื่อเกิดเหตุการณ์ (event) ด้วยพิกัดระดับน้ำเงินด้านขวาของหน้าจอคอมพิวเตอร์ของผู้ใช้.

คำแนะนำ:เพื่อได้รับตำแหน่งตัวชิ้นส่วนของตัวชิ้นส่วนนี้เมื่อตัวชิ้นส่วนนี้มีความเกี่ยวข้องกับพิกัดระดับน้ำเงินด้านล่างของหน้าจอคอมพิวเตอร์ของผู้ใช้ ใช้ screenY คุณสมบัติ.

หมายเหตุ:คุณสมบัตินี้เป็นคุณสมบัติที่แสดงเฉพาะ (read-only).

ตัวอย่าง

ตัวอย่าง 1

ได้รับตำแหน่งตัวชิ้นส่วนของตัวชิ้นส่วนนี้เมื่อคลิกที่ปุ่มหมุนตามหลังของแมวหน้าที่ตัวชิ้นส่วนนี้:

var x = event.screenX;     // ได้รับค่าพิกัดตั้งแต่ด้านขวา
var y = event.screenY;     // ได้รับค่าพิกัดตั้งแต่ด้านล่าง
var coor = "X coords: " + x + ", Y coords: " + y;

ทดลองด้วยตัวเอง

ตัวอย่าง 2

แสดงรายละเอียดของความแตกต่างระหว่าง clientX และ clientY และ screenX และ screenY:

var cX = event.clientX;
var sX = event.screenX;
var cY = event.clientY;
var sY = event.screenY;
var coords1 = "client - X: " + cX + ", Y coords: " + cY;
var coords2 = "screen - X: " + sX + ", Y coords: " + sY;

ทดลองด้วยตัวเอง

รูปแบบการใช้งาน

event.screenX

รายละเอียดเทคนิค

ค่าที่กลับมาที่มีในตัวแปร: ค่าเลขาที่แสดงตำแหน่งตัวบนพิกัดระดับน้ำเงินด้านขวาของตัวชิ้นส่วนนี้ด้วยพิกัดพิเศษ (pixel).
DOM ระดับ: DOM ระดับ 2 หาความเกี่ยวข้อง

浏览器支持

属性 Chrome IE Firefox Safari Opera
screenX สนับสนุน สนับสนุน สนับสนุน สนับสนุน สนับสนุน

หน้าที่เกี่ยวข้อง

คู่มือ HTML DOM ฉบับ:MouseEvent 属性 screenY

คู่มือ HTML DOM ฉบับ:MouseEvent 属性 clientX

คู่มือ HTML DOM ฉบับ:MouseEvent 属性 clientY

คู่มือ HTML DOM ฉบับ:MouseEvent 属性 offsetX

คู่มือ HTML DOM ฉบับ:MouseEvent 属性 offsetY